Should no one he can support step up to seek the seat from Ward 4 in 2020, however, Barrette would reconsider his decision to forego another attempt at serving on the board from Ward 4. He said, however, that he’s sure there are ample candidates in his ward. He urged them to run for his post. He said the “right Republican, Democrat or non-partisan should step forward soon.”

“This has been a wonderful chance to serve the citizens of Carson City,” Barrette said, “but it is time to pass this role on to a younger representative to help forge the type of sustainable community we all seek for the next decade and beyond.”

Barrette, 77, said his intention is to return to writing immediately. He is president of JB WebWords, LLC, a company he and his wife formed years ago. It is a firm that has remained in moth balls until now.

Barrette said he will complete his term until January 2021, but will return to what he called his day job by writing regularly. Other board members have day jobs, but he left his writing post in the news business in 2016 to run for his seat from Ward 4. He hasn’t written for regular publication since.

“My thanks to the people of Carson City for affording me this opportunity in public life,” he said. It was an honor to hold office, he added, but said he intends to return to the best and “highest office in the United States – Carson City citizen.”
